


This work stages a quiet confrontation between void and heat: matte blacks on the left absorb perception, while a rusted red field on the right radiates like contained ember. At the center, a luminous, eye-like ovalβstitched from countless linear filamentsβfloats within a deep blue cross, suggesting a compass point, a wound, or a portal where energies are measured and held in balance. The rigor of the divided panels reads as architectural, yet the vibrating hatchwork introduces a pulse of interior life, turning geometry into a meditation on symmetry, surveillance, and the fragile act of seeing.
